Roadsaw - See You in Hell

Appealing stoner rock on comeback album from Boston-based hard rock outfit, Roadsaw
The hairy men of Roadsaw made a good name for themselves with albums like ‘Nationwide’ and the appropriately titled ‘Rawk’n’Roll’ before splitting so members could embark on similar projects like the Southern Rock combo Antler and hard rockers Quitter. Core Roadsaw members Craig Riggs, guitarist Ian Ross and bassist Tim Catz have apparently decided there’s no good reason not to dust off the old name and it take it out on the road again, and so have done so with Milligram shredder Darryl Shepard and Jeremy Hemond, late of Boston rockers Sin City Chainsaw and Cortez, on drums. Thus, ‘See You In Hell’ continues in a straight line from Antler’s ‘Nothing That A Bullet Couldn’t Cure’ – and there’s nothing wrong with that if you like thundering fuzz riffs and galloping rhythm sections fronted by a tuneful howler. The band does a good job of giving the songs an individual twist - ‘Go It Alone’ takes a more melodic turn and sports some sensitive lyrics. The stomping lurch of the title track comes garnished with a few organ flourishes and slows it down for some soulful crooning from Riggs. ‘Dead Horse’ trots further afield with spacey leads floating around a strummed acoustic guitar. ‘Leavin’ features some heavily distorted slide. If you’ve followed Roadsaw and Antler this far, there’s every reason to pick up ‘See You In Hell’, and stoner rock aficionados who have skipped over the band before now should have no qualms about jumping aboard.
